[UDP] User remains blocked from entering UDP settings after enabling Cloud Services
After installing the Universal Distribution Portal (UDP) package, "UDP Settings" will be exposed to the user. If the user's project is not registered with Cloud Services when trying to access these UDP Settings, the Inspector pane will block the Settings view, displaying a message referring to the Services window and a button redirecting there. After activating Cloud Services, if the user returns to the UDP Settings Inspector pane, they will remain blocked from accessing the UDP Settings until defocusing the asset in the Inspector pane (focusing another asset) and refocusing.
Steps to reproduce:
- In Unity 2019.3, create a new project and install the Universal Distribution Portal (UDP) package
- Menu: Window > Universal Distribution Portal > Settings
- Observe in the UDP Settings Inspector pane, that the settings are blocked from the user until they register the project with Cloud Services
- UDP Settings Inspector pane > Click "Go to Services Window"
- Register the project with Cloud Services
- Return to the UDP Settings Inspector pane
- Observe the user is still blocked from the settings referencing Cloud Services, however the project has been registered
- Focus on any other asset in the Inspector
- Re-focus the UDP Settings asset
- Observe the settings are now unlocked
